I had an unusual situation, where my Wm6 phone (htc touch 3g) would not connect to a wifi router (802.11G) that was set to channel 13. I’m in Australia, so I should be able to use channels 1 – 13. Korean network operator KT and Samsung launch in South Korea the new M8400 smartphone that supports WCDMA 3G, WiFi and WiBro (Korean version of WiMAX) connectivity. Acer, who entered the smartphone market this year, has launched ten phones so far: nine for Windows Mobile and one for Android ( that would be the Liquid ). Not too bad.
